Output 21c65107cccc15b51efd7e74a3fb01e0537e8b38ac7d4fb8cafbd48ea1e4d967:17

value
156086
script pubkey
OP_0 OP_PUSHBYTES_20 42651cade0a0a18bebb8c8b05505300cb75c3121
address
bc1qgfj3et0q5zsch6acezc92pfspjm4cvfpwz07g7
transaction
21c65107cccc15b51efd7e74a3fb01e0537e8b38ac7d4fb8cafbd48ea1e4d967
spent
true